Some lenders may require a pest control or termite letter, in addition to the survey and appraisal of the property, before approving a loan. The report must prove that the property is free of an infestation by wood-destroying organisms.
In states such as Georgia, where wood infestation by beetles or termites presents a serious problem, lenders will not secure a loan without the termite and wood infestation letter.
Some lenders also require a flood certification and environmental inspection before approving a loan on a property, to determine if the property is in a flood prone area, or if it is a site, where any known environmental hazards have been disposed. |
